Proactive Preventive Maintenance


Preventive maintenance helps commercial trucks remain safer, more reliable, and better prepared for daily operations. Regular service often allows worn components to be found early, before they turn into expensive repairs or unexpected breakdowns. Our preventive maintenance programs include inspections of brakes, steering, suspension, fluids, filters, belts, batteries, tires, and other critical systems based on vehicle use and recommended service intervals. This proactive approach helps fleet operators improve performance, extend equipment life, and reduce costly interruptions.

Our technicians use advanced diagnostic tools and proven service procedures to evaluate each and every vehicle carefully. We explain inspection results, recommend maintenance based on operating conditions, and help prioritize future service needs. Whether you operate one commercial truck or manage a larger fleet, scheduled maintenance makes vehicle care more predictable and efficient. With consistent service, your business can improve uptime, lower long-term repair costs, and keep trucks completely ready for the work ahead.

Scheduled Fleet Maintenance Programs


A planned maintenance program helps commercial fleets stay ahead of wear, service needs, and preventable repairs. Best One Fleet creates scheduled service plans for trucks and fleet vehicles based on mileage, usage, operating conditions, and the demands of your business. Instead of waiting for problems to interrupt the workday, routine maintenance gives you a clearer picture of what each vehicle needs and when service should be completed.

Our scheduled fleet maintenance may include fluid service, filter replacement, brake checks, tire inspections, suspension review, battery testing, lighting checks, belt and hose inspections, and other essential services. Each visit is an opportunity to catch developing issues early and help reduce the risk of unexpected downtime.

We keep the process organized by explaining service findings, helping prioritize repairs, and working with your schedule whenever possible. For fleet managers and business owners, this creates a simpler way to maintain vehicle reliability, plan repair costs, and keep trucks ready for daily routes, job sites, deliveries, and long-distance travel.
